True that FR is allowing warranty claim work at CWs. The bad news is, if a large part is required, FR waits until another camper is scheduled for delivery in the area so they can combine shipments. The replacement counter top awaits a free ride in some other trailer. I had a similar situation awaiting replacement of improper waste water tanks. It stretched out to 4+ months, including when the trailer to be delivered went missing for more than a week. The driver ran out of allowable driving hours and just walked away. Go figure.

Good luck on any Forest River warranty work- my countertop was damaged by a leaking, improperly installed, rear window. Warranty will cover it.
I was told directly by Forest River personnel it would be 2 weeks to get a counter top. When I told the dealer this they laughed- yeah right they said! It has now been 8 weeks. So yeah they have a "bumper to bumper" one year warranty...but if they can't send out a part in a timely manner, what good is it? |
